4. |
Do you have a Social Security card and number? This is necessary if you
will be earning money in the U.S. and is required to obtain a California
driver's license or California identification (ID) card. You may obtain
application forms and more information at SISS You must present your
passport and immigration documents to demonstrate your legal status when
you apply at the Social Security Office. |

6. |
It is absolutely essential that you and your family members have health
insurance throughout your stay in the U.S. Medical care in the U.S. is
extremely expensive. If you are employed by UCD, ask your department if
UCD will provide health insurance coverage. If not, ask for information
on insurance at SISS. |

8. |
Are you accompanied by school-aged children? Contact the Davis School
District Office, 526 B Street, (530) 757-5300, and you will be referred
to the appropriate school. You must present proof of birth date (birth
or baptismal certificate) and immunization records at the school to
enroll your children. Davis schools start the first week in September
and are in session until mid-June with summer vacation from mid-June
through August. |
